Tips for Finding Optimal Hotel Packages

Locating suitable lodging deals requires careful planning and research. The following tips offer guidance for navigating available options effectively.

Tip 1: Specify Search Parameters: Define trip dates and desired amenities to refine search results and avoid irrelevant offers. For example, specifying “weekend getaway with spa access” clarifies search intent.

Tip 2: Compare Across Multiple Platforms: Utilize various search engines, online travel agencies, and hotel websites directly to ensure a comprehensive view of available options and identify the best possible value.

Tip 3: Read Reviews Carefully: Examine feedback from previous guests regarding package inclusions, overall hotel quality, and customer service. Focus on verified reviews to mitigate the influence of biased opinions.

Tip 4: Understand Inclusions and Exclusions: Pay close attention to the fine print to identify precisely what the package includes and excludes. Note any resort fees, parking charges, or incidental expenses not covered within the advertised rate.

Tip 5: Consider Package Value Versus Individual Bookings: Evaluate the overall cost of the bundled offer against booking accommodations and amenities separately. In some instances, individual bookings may offer greater flexibility and cost savings.

Tip 6: Look for Seasonal Promotions and Special Offers: Hotels often offer discounted packages during off-season periods or for specific events. Remaining flexible with travel dates can unlock significant cost savings.

Tip 7: Contact the Hotel Directly: Clarify any ambiguities regarding package details or negotiate potential upgrades or add-ons by communicating directly with hotel staff.

6. Booking Platform

6. Booking Platform, Near Me

The booking platform employed for researching and reserving localized hotel packages significantly influences the options presented, pricing structures encountered, and overall user experience. Understanding the nuances of various booking platforms proves essential for effectively navigating the “hotel packages near me” landscape. Each platform operates under distinct business models, impacting pricing strategies, available inventory, and user interface design. Recognizing these distinctions empowers informed decision-making and optimizes the search process for localized hotel deals.

  • Online Travel Agencies (OTAs)

    OTAs aggregate inventory from numerous hotels, presenting a broad spectrum of options to consumers. Examples include Expedia, Booking.com, and Hotels.com. These platforms often feature competitive pricing due to negotiated agreements with hotels and access to a wider pool of inventory. However, they may also introduce booking fees or prioritize certain properties based on commission structures. In the context of “hotel packages near me,” OTAs provide a convenient starting point for comparing various options across different hotels within a specific geographic area. However, relying solely on OTAs may limit exposure to exclusive deals or packages offered directly by hotels.

  • Direct Hotel Websites

    Booking directly through a hotel’s website often provides access to exclusive deals and packages not available through third-party platforms. This direct channel allows hotels to maintain control over pricing and customize offerings to target specific demographics. For example, a hotel might offer a “locals only” package exclusively on its website to attract regional clientele. In the context of “hotel packages near me,” exploring direct hotel websites can uncover hidden gems or specialized deals catering to localized interests. This approach often bypasses intermediary fees, potentially leading to cost savings. However, it requires more individual research effort to compare options across multiple hotels.

  • Metasearch Engines

    Metasearch engines like Kayak and Google Hotels collate data from various OTAs and direct hotel websites, presenting a comprehensive overview of available options and pricing variations. These platforms facilitate comparison shopping without directly handling the booking process. Users are redirected to the chosen platform to complete the reservation. For “hotel packages near me” searches, metasearch engines offer a convenient tool for quickly assessing the competitive landscape and identifying potential cost disparities across different platforms for similar packages. However, users must remain mindful of potential price fluctuations and verify details directly on the final booking platform.

  • Specialty Travel Platforms

    Niche platforms catering to specific travel segments, like luxury travel or family vacations, curate packages tailored to particular interests. Examples include Mr & Mrs Smith for boutique hotels or Kid & Coe for family-friendly accommodations. These platforms often emphasize curated experiences and personalized recommendations, aligning with specific travel styles. For “hotel packages near me” searches within a niche segment, these specialized platforms provide access to tailored packages often unavailable through broader platforms. However, their specialized focus may limit the range of available options within a given geographic area.

7. Travel Dates

7. Travel Dates, Near Me

Travel dates exert a significant influence on both availability and pricing within the realm of localized hotel packages. The principle of supply and demand dictates that periods of high demand, such as holidays or special events, typically correlate with increased prices and reduced availability. Conversely, periods of low demand, often during the off-season or weekdays, frequently yield lower prices and greater availability. This dynamic relationship between travel dates and market fluctuations necessitates careful consideration when searching for “hotel packages near me.” A traveler seeking a weekend getaway package in a popular tourist destination during peak season, for example, should anticipate higher prices and limited availability compared to the same package offered mid-week during the off-season. This understanding allows travelers to strategically adjust travel dates to optimize cost savings or secure desired accommodations.

Flexibility with travel dates often unlocks access to more favorable package deals. Hotels frequently employ dynamic pricing strategies, adjusting rates based on real-time occupancy and demand forecasts. A traveler open to shifting travel dates by a few days might discover significant price variations for the same “hotel package near me.” This flexibility proves particularly advantageous when searching for packages incorporating flights or other travel components subject to fluctuating prices. Moreover, some hotels offer specific discounts or promotions tied to particular travel dates, such as “mid-week specials” or “early bird” discounts. Remaining attuned to these promotional periods enhances the potential for securing optimal value. For instance, a business traveler seeking a package near a convention center might find substantial savings by extending the trip to include a weekend, capitalizing on lower weekend rates. Conversely, a leisure traveler seeking a beach resort package might find better deals during the shoulder seasons (spring or fall) compared to the peak summer months.

Frequently Asked Questions

This section addresses common inquiries regarding localized hotel package searches.

Question 1: What constitutes a typical hotel package?

Hotel packages typically combine accommodations with additional components such as meals, amenities (spa treatments, fitness center access), activities (tickets to attractions, tours), or transportation services (airport transfers, parking). Specific inclusions vary significantly based on the hotel, location, and target audience.

Question 2: How do geographic search parameters influence results?

Search parameters like “near me” prioritize results based on proximity to the user’s location. This prioritization ensures that displayed results align with the user’s immediate geographic context, focusing on options within a defined radius.

Question 3: Do package prices remain consistent across different platforms?

Package prices can fluctuate across different booking platforms (online travel agencies, direct hotel websites, metasearch engines) due to variations in commission structures, negotiated rates, and dynamic pricing strategies. Comparing prices across multiple platforms is advisable.

Question 4: What role do user reviews play in evaluating package quality?

User reviews offer insights into the experiences of previous guests, providing valuable perspectives on package components, hotel quality, and overall satisfaction. Analyzing reviews helps assess alignment between advertised offerings and actual experiences.

Question 5: How does seasonality influence package availability and pricing?

Peak travel seasons often correlate with higher prices and reduced availability due to increased demand. Traveling during the off-season or shoulder periods frequently yields lower prices and greater availability.

Question 6: What are the advantages of booking directly through a hotel’s website?

Booking directly often unlocks access to exclusive deals and packages unavailable through third-party platforms. This direct channel also facilitates personalized communication with hotel staff regarding specific requests or modifications.
